Table of ContentsReviewsFor fans of animals that are the exceptions to most rules, this fun series highlights the peculiarities of readers' favorite amphibians, birds, fish, invertebrates, mammals, and reptiles--from immortal sea creatures to bugs that see their whole life in a few hours. High-interest foci like limb regrowth and topical insects such as the 17-year cicada are covered, while the series also still addresses the major facets of each classification of creature. Titles feature short facts alongside the meatier discussions and highlighted vocabulary for scientific literacy, boosting, and retention. Back matter includes a glossary, Read More section, websites, and index. VERDICT These books are an exciting must-have for middle graders interested in the exciting aspects of the life sciences.--Lisa Bosarge, Enoch Pratt Free Library, Baltimore School Library Journal Author InformationJaclyn Jaycox is a children's book author and editor.
